Eligibility The ETR is obtainable to families obtaining the Family Tax Advantage Part A (FTB Aspect A). The FTB Aspect A is a separate existing tax advantage which is given by the Household Support Office as fortnightly payments to households that meet the Earnings Check. We will not go into all the guidelines relating to qualifying for the FTB Component A, but basically households that have a total loved ones earnings of much less than a particular threshold will obtain this tax benefit. In the 08-09 12 months, this limit was ,514 (for people with below 18 dependants) or ,962 for households with some dependants about eighteen. Add ,796 to the respective restrict for every additional little one. So basically if your family income was much less than this limit, you would be eligible for the FTB Component A, and therefore the ETR (whether you currently obtain the FTB is irrelevant, your household just wants to be qualified for it).
Moreover, for the reasons of the ETR, any cash flow in the kind of youth allowance, disability assistance or ABSTUDY (there are a handful of other people) do not count to this restrict. So if your family cash flow falls underneath the threshold for the FTB Component A but for individuals payments in respect of your kid, you are still qualified for the ETR.
Allowable costs
Generally, all expenses that (in the phrases of the federal government) “assistance a kid for the duration of college and strengthen high quality of education” are allowable. For instance:
Laptops & residence computer systems and linked fees (which includes repair and working costs of computer devices and lease expenses), property Internet connection and printers and paper Training computer software College textbooks and materials (like prescribed textbooks, associated mastering resources, study guides and stationery) Prescribed trade equipment
The listing over is not exhaustive, but give you an thought of what are allowable expenditures.
Discover that all school textbooks and products are allowable. For example, you or your youngster might have bought HSC textbooks, or prescribed texts for HSC English – claim these! Your family web connection is also claimable. Just don’t forget to maintain your receipts. If you acquire claimable products 2nd hand from personal sellers, request a receipt (a straightforward notice noting the items / service, the price tag and date will suffice).
Even so, tuition expenses (such as payments to Dux College or other HSC tuition schools) and school fees are not allowable expenses. Nor are non-education relevant software such as personal computer video games, or hardware used for such purposes, obviously.
How to claim
The ETR is claimed when dad and mom full their annual tax return. For these using the e-Tax software program, there will be a part for the ETR. Just bear in mind to maintain those receipts!
